Efficient Diagnosis Assignment Using Unstructured Clinical Notes (2023.acl-short)

| Challenge: | Electronic phenotyping entails using electronic health records (EHRs) to identify patients with specific clinical outcomes and determine when those outcomes occurred. |
| Approach: | They propose a framework for electronic phenotyping that integrates labeling functions and a disease-agnostic neural network to assign diagnoses to patients. |
| Outcome: | The proposed framework disambiguates hypertension true positives and false positives with a supervised area under the precision-recall curve (AUPRC) of 0.85. |
